The decision to hire a law firm for your child's cerebral paralysis lawsuit is one of the most important choices you'll make. You must be able to trust your legal team to handle every aspect of the lawsuit, so you can concentrate on your child's needs.

Cerebral palsy is a condition that affects movement and coordination. It can result in a variety of disabilities including developmental delays, skeletal issues and limb-related abnormalities such as spasticity (extremely stiff or tight muscles), dyskinesia, (rapid rapid jerking movements) as well as ataxia (balance motor control and balance issues). The severity of CP symptoms can vary depending on what type of brain injury caused it.

A cerebral palsy attorney can help you get the money you need to cover your child's special care. This may include a combination of therapy including occupational, speech and physical, surgery, medication and special equipment, as well living accommodations. They should also be familiar of the laws governing education for children with CP and the various advantages that are available to help them achieve their full potential.

Your lawyer will file the claim on behalf of you, and the medical professionals responsible for the birth injury of your child will become defendants. Your lawyer will then collect medical records as well as other evidence to prove your case. Most cases are settled outside of court, but your lawyer should be prepared to go to trial in the event of a need.

CP can be caused by a trauma to the central nervous system or brain that occurs before birth, during the delivery process, or at any age following a trauma. This neurodevelopmental disorder can affect motor control and movement as well as speech, vision and more. Some children with CP are able to live full and active lives while others require intensive care and 24 hour care.

Medical professionals are required to maintain an extremely high standard of patient care. If they fail to comply with this requirement and patients suffer an injury that results in CP the medical professional could be held responsible for medical malpractice.

Families must be able to prove, in order to prevail in a CP case that the medical professional acted in violation of their professional standards and caused a child's injury. They must also prove that the injury caused damage that is quantifiable that includes pain, suffering and loss of income, medical expenses and special education needs.
